Orlando Triumphs Over Atlanta in Tense 1-0 Victory: A Comprehensive Analysis

In a dramatic contest on November 24, 2024, Orlando City SC narrowly defeated Atlanta United FC 1-0, in a match that showcased tactical brilliance, resilient defense, and moments of individual excellence. The outcome was shaped by Orlando’s disciplined approach and key performances from standout players, marking another important milestone in their ongoing battle for supremacy in Major League Soccer (MLS). This article takes an in-depth look at the key moments, player performances, and the broader implications of this thrilling showdown.

The Build-Up to the Match: Intense Rivalry and High Stakes

The clash between Orlando and Atlanta is always charged with a palpable sense of rivalry. Both teams have enjoyed periods of success in MLS, and their meetings are often defined by high energy and fierce competition. Heading into this encounter, Orlando sat in a strong position within the playoff race, while Atlanta was hoping to regain momentum after a series of inconsistent performances.

Orlando entered the match with a record of solid defensive performances, led by their experienced backline and the ever-dangerous attacking duo of Facundo Torres and Duncan McGuire. Meanwhile, Atlanta had been looking to bounce back from a series of disappointing results, but with a squad packed with talent, including Thiago Almada and Giorgos Giakoumakis, expectations were high.

As the teams took to the field, it was clear that the match would not only have significant implications for the playoff standings but also for the players’ confidence and team momentum. The stage was set for a thrilling encounter.

Key Moments and Tactical Breakdown

First Half: A Tactical Battle in the Midfield

The first half was a closely contested affair, with both teams employing contrasting tactical approaches. Orlando City focused on a more structured defensive shape, sitting deep to absorb Atlanta’s attacking pressure, while looking to exploit space on the counter-attack. On the other hand, Atlanta dominated possession, with a midfield focused on creativity and transition play, but struggled to break down Orlando’s disciplined defense.

  • Orlando’s Compact Defense: Orlando’s defensive unit, led by central defenders Robin Jansson and Antonio Carlos, remained compact and disciplined throughout the first half. Their ability to nullify Atlanta’s forward pressure was crucial in maintaining their shape and preventing clear-cut chances.
  • Atlanta’s Possession Game: Atlanta’s approach was based on their ability to maintain possession, moving the ball quickly through the midfield with Almada and Santiago Sosa pulling the strings. Despite this dominance, they were unable to penetrate Orlando’s well-organized defense.
  • McGuire’s Threat on the Counter: While Atlanta held most of the ball, Orlando’s counter-attacks were a constant threat, with McGuire and Torres combining well to stretch the Atlanta defense. A few key moments saw McGuire testing Atlanta’s goalkeeper, Brad Guzan, but the veteran shot-stopper remained sharp.

Second Half: The Decisive Moment

The second half saw both teams pushing for a breakthrough. With the scoreline still 0-0, the match was on a knife’s edge, and it was evident that the next goal would be crucial. Atlanta continued to control possession, but Orlando’s counter-attacks were increasingly dangerous, with McGuire becoming more influential as the match wore on.

In the 68th minute, Orlando finally broke the deadlock. After a quick transition play, Torres found McGuire in space, who expertly finished past Guzan with a clinical strike. The goal highlighted Orlando’s ability to capitalize on Atlanta’s vulnerabilities in transition and put them in a commanding position.

  • McGuire’s Composure: Duncan McGuire’s goal was the product of both individual skill and excellent team play. His calm finish under pressure was a testament to his growth as a forward and his ability to make decisive contributions in high-stakes moments.
  • Atlanta’s Response: After conceding, Atlanta threw more bodies forward, but their attack lacked precision and often ran into the resolute Orlando defense. Almada and Giakoumakis had chances, but neither was able to break through, with goalkeeper Mason Stajduhar making crucial saves to preserve the lead.
